“Ceiling aircon” covers several quite different machines, and knowing which one is above your ceiling changes both the service scope and the price. The quickest test is what you can see from the floor:
| Type | What you see from below | How it is serviced |
|---|---|---|
| Ceiling cassette | A square or rectangular grille flush in the ceiling, blowing from all four sides | Front panel and filters drop down; coil, blower and drain pan reached from below |
| Ceiling-concealed / ducted | Only supply diffusers and a separate return-air grille — the unit itself is hidden | Through an access panel in the ceiling; filters may sit at the return grille instead |
| Ceiling-exposed (ceiling-suspended) | A visible box mounted under the ceiling, blowing along it | Similar to a wall unit but at height — access equipment still needed |
| AHU / FCU on a riser | Nothing — it is in a plant space or ceiling void serving several rooms | Plant-room access, filter bank changes, coil cleaning; surveyed, not rate-carded |
| Indoor unit of a VRF/VRV system | Looks like a cassette, but many of them share one outdoor system | Serviced as a system — see the VRF servicing guide |

On a wall split, access is free. On a ceiling unit it is often the largest single variable in the quote, and it is entirely determined by decisions made when the ceiling went in. Things that push a straightforward service into a difficult one:
Two practical asks: make sure every ceiling unit and every condensate pump has a permanent access panel, and keep a simple asset list of what is above each ceiling. Both are cheap to arrange and both reduce every future visit.
Most cassettes and concealed units cannot drain by gravity, because the drain line has to run through the ceiling void to a distant point. A small condensate pump lifts the water instead, usually triggered by a float in the drain pan.
This is the component that turns a maintenance oversight into a claim. When the pan silts up, or the float sticks, or the pump gives up, the water has nowhere to go but over the edge of the pan into the ceiling. What the tenant sees is a stained tile or a drip onto a desk; what has actually happened is a slow overflow that may have been soaking insulation and cabling for days.
A competent service visit therefore treats the drainage as a first-class item, not an afterthought: the pan is cleaned rather than wiped, the float is checked for free movement, the pump is proved to run and lift, and water is poured into the pan at the end to demonstrate it clears. If a service report does not mention the drain pump on a cassette, the visit was incomplete. Use this as a scope to hold a contractor to. A visit that skips the bottom three rows is a wipe, not a service:
| Task | Typical frequency | What it protects |
|---|---|---|
| Filter removal, wash and refit | Every visit — quarterly for most offices | Airflow, running cost, coil cleanliness |
| Grille and front-panel clean | Every visit | Appearance and airflow |
| Evaporator coil condition check | Every visit | Decides whether a chemical wash is due |
| Blower / fan barrel clean | Every visit, deeper at wash | Airflow and noise; a caked barrel halves delivery |
| Drain pan clean and flush | Every visit | The overflow that ruins ceilings |
| Condensate pump test and float check | Every visit | The commonest cause of a ceiling flood |
| Electrical connections and controls check | Every visit | Loose terminals, failed sensors, controller faults |
| Outdoor coil clean and clearance check | Every visit | Heat rejection — where cooling capacity is quietly lost |
| Operating readings taken and recorded | Every visit | Trend data; catches a decline before a breakdown |
| Full chemical wash of coil, blower and drain | Annually, or when condition calls for it | Restores capacity; removes mould and odour |
| Written service report, per unit | Every visit | Your maintenance history, budgeting and audit evidence |
The last row is the one cheap contracts skip and facility managers value most — a report per visit, per unit, so you have a record rather than an invoice and a promise.
A ceiling-concealed unit adds a complication a cassette does not have: the air it cools does not arrive at the machine directly. It is drawn through a return-air grille, along a return path or plenum, through a filter that may be at the grille rather than at the unit, and then pushed out through supply ductwork to the diffusers.
That path is where concealed systems are routinely neglected:
Cleaning the machine and cleaning the ductwork are two different jobs, and the second is only sometimes warranted — our duct cleaning guide sets out how to tell, because “your ducts need cleaning” is a very common sale that is very often the wrong fix.
The cassette figures below are published market ranges for exactly this job. The ducted and AHU rows genuinely have no honest number, and it is worth being clear why: the work is set by the access route, the filter arrangement, the length and condition of the ductwork and the plant space — variables that differ per building, not per unit. A contractor who gives you a firm ducted price over the phone has priced a guess:
| Job | Indicative cost | Note |
|---|---|---|
| Per-visit servicing, commercial split or cassette | RM80 – RM150 per unit | Routine PM visit; scales down with a scheduled contract |
| Full chemical wash, ceiling cassette | RM250 – RM400 per unit | Coil, blower and drain; annually for most units |
| Routine service, residential ceiling / cassette unit | RM120 – RM180 per unit | The home equivalent of the PM visit above |
| Ceiling-concealed / ducted unit service | Quoted after survey | Access panel, filter location and duct condition decide it |
| AHU / FCU with a filter bank | Quoted after survey | Filter specification and plant access decide it |
| VRF / VRV system PM | Quoted after survey | Serviced as a system, not as a count of indoor units |
| Difficult access (high ceiling, no panel, platform needed) | Quoted after survey | Often the largest single variable in a ceiling job |
One clarification worth making, because it comes up constantly: ClickBina’s flat RM130/unit chemical wash offer is for 1.0–1.5HP wall units — the standard home split. A ceiling cassette is a bigger, harder job and is priced separately, as the table shows. Anyone quoting you a wall-unit rate for a cassette either has not understood the job or has not seen it. For one or two cassettes in a small office, calling someone when it is due is perfectly rational. Past roughly a handful of units, ad-hoc servicing starts to fail for reasons that have nothing to do with price: nobody owns the schedule, the units drift out of cycle, and the first sign that a drain pump has failed is a ceiling stain.
A scheduled agreement fixes the ownership problem more than the cost problem.
